    "Half & Half" pie review only: 'North Of Brooklyn Pizza'…read moreused to helm the rear of this great venue (maybe about a year or so ago). NOB left and the pizzeria at the back is now part of Get Well Bar's food menu. Although their website doesnt detail this, they offer 18" pies after 5pm everyday, and seemingly use a sourdough dough. A "Cheese" pie is $27 (tomato sauce + shredded mozz; same price as NOB's NY Cheese & Margherita pies). There is "Pepperoni" (Ezzo branded; $30), "Mushroom" (garlic oil base, shredded mozz, Portobello and Cremini mushrooms, goat cheese, balsamic glaze, and arugula; $32), "Vegan Deluxe" (tomato sauce, vegan mozz, artichoke, mushroom blend, black olives, red onions; $32), and "Al Pastor" (tomato sauce, shredded mozz, marinated pork shoulder, pickled jalapenos, brined red onions, pineapple salsa ; $32). In comparison, NOB's most expensive pies are $30). They have a "Half & Half" pie ($34) which is a pie divided in half with 2 different flavours each side, which is what was ordered. Asked "well done." The "Cheese" was underwhelming except for the dough, which was phenomenally pillowy and soft (not in an under-done sense, just almost like a croissant), but the pie overall could definitely have been more "well-done." We might have gotten lucky in using the least stale dough they had, but certainly the dough was impressive, but lacked any char, smokiness, or notable crispness (except along outer inch). The "Mushroom" side was superb, and it was a pity it was called just "Mushroom" as it was much more than a Funghi pie. A diversity of flavours accompanied each bite (slight tartness and creaminess from goat cheese, strong herbal notes from arugula, earthiness of mushrooms, sweetness from balsamic glaze...). It might not appeal to everyone, but it was a great balance to enjoy it alongside the more basic "Cheese" pizza side. Overall, not as good as its former tenant, but the "Half & Half" pie is a great pie worth trying and an impressive pizza for a fantastic bar.

    A classic Punk / Rock n Roll Bar in Toronto CA. Basically the CBGB's of that scene…read more It's been around since the early 1990's and is exactly what a spot like this should be. Very nondescript outside facade - no sign telling you what it is other than a small "BSC" (for Bovine Sex Club) painted near the door. Hard to miss though as the exterior is made up a punk rock style sculpture of rusted bikes & other assorted ephemera. The interior is similar, visually. Great sound system & chill vibes pervade throughout. Weirdly the stage is right in the entrance of the club, on your left, with a long bar along the right side, heading back. Great, crowd, great location in cool area with lots of restaurants & plenty of parking - both on the street up to 2 hours & extended parking for a flat-rate of CA$20 (~$14 USD) from 6:00pm until the next morning, just 2 blacks away.
